Types of Childcare
There are lots of forms of childcare available near myself, including daycare centers, home-based treatment, and preschool programs. Daycare centers are generally large facilities that will accommodate most kiddies, while home-based care providers run out of their very own houses. Preschool programs are made to prepare kids for preschool and past, with a focus on early knowledge and socialization.
Every type of child care has its own benefits and drawbacks. Daycare centers offer a structured environment with trained staff and academic activities, nevertheless they are costly and may even have long waiting listings. Home-based treatment providers offer a far more individualized and flexible strategy, but may not have exactly the same standard of supervision as daycare centers. Preschool programs offer a good educational basis for kids, but might not be suited to all families due to price or place.
